84 changes: 84 additions & 0 deletions inventories/broker.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,84 @@
#!/usr/bin/env python

import argparse
import json
import yaml
import os
import subprocess
import sys

try:
from StringIO import StringIO # pyright: reportMissingImports=false
except ImportError:
from io import StringIO # pyright: reportMissingImports=false

from collections import defaultdict


try:
DEVNULL = subprocess.DEVNULL
except AttributeError:
DEVNULL = open(os.devnull, 'w')


def parse_args():
parser = argparse.ArgumentParser(description="Broker inventory script")
group = parser.add_mutually_exclusive_group(required=True)
group.add_argument('--list', action='store_true')
group.add_argument('--host')
return parser.parse_args()


def get_running_hosts():
try:
subprocess.check_call(["which", "broker"], stdout=DEVNULL)
except subprocess.CalledProcessError:
return

cmd = "broker inventory --details"
output = subprocess.check_output(cmd.split(), universal_newlines=True).rstrip()

hosts = yaml.safe_load(output)
return hosts.values()


def list_running_hosts():
hosts = get_running_hosts()
variables = dict(get_configs(hosts))

return {
"_meta": {
"hostvars": variables,
},
"all": {
"hosts": [host['hostname'] for host in hosts],
},
}


def get_configs(hosts):
if not hosts:
return

for host in hosts:
details = {
'ansible_host': host['ip'],
'ansible_port': '22',
'ansible_user': 'root'
}
yield host['hostname'], details


def main():
args = parse_args()
hosts = list_running_hosts()

if args.list:
json.dump(hosts, sys.stdout)
elif args.host:
details = hosts['_meta']['hostvars']
json.dump(details[args.host], sys.stdout)


if __name__ == '__main__':
main()
